In this article we study the integration of a solar plant to a copper recuperation process in Northern Chile. We analyze the integration of concentrating and non-concentrating solar energy technologies, identifying their main advantages and disadvantages. Given the energy demand of the process, solar field areas over 30,000 m² are studied.
